They can’t hold up this train!

President Cleveland, a railroad engineer, drives a locomotive labeled “Administration R.R.” that is roaring out of a tunnel labeled “Business Depression Tunnel,” and knocking out of the way legislators who are placing “Dilatory Admendments” and “Teller’s Dilatory Tactics” on the tracks, trying to derail the train. Among the legislators are Francis M. Cockrell, James Z. George, James L. Pugh, William A. Peffer, George G. Vest, James D. Cameron, William M. Stewart, Henry M. Teller, John P. Jones, and Edward O. Wolcott.

Memorandum from the United States Postal Service on Charles Fitzgerald

Outline of the career of Charles Fitzgerald, including the names of those who recommended his promotions to Railroad Postal Clerk and Post Office Inspector. Handwritten notes of Theodore Roosevelt: “A native Mississippian and a Democrat; voted for Cleveland and Bryan.” Note in another hand: “F[ile] under Indianola.”
